This test bank covers Chapters 1 through 16 of Supply Chain Management: A Logistics Perspective, 9th Edition by John Coyle and Langley. It includes exam-style questions focused on logistics strategy, supply chain integration, transportation, warehousing, inventory management, sourcing, and global supply chain operations. The material is suitable for exam preparation, concept review, and comprehensive study in supply chain and logistics management courses.
